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.08.28;
Скачать: CL | DM;

Вниз

звук   Найти похожие ветки 

 
Артем1   (2003-03-30 13:28) [0]

Подскажите пожалуйста! Как в дельфи написать примочку к электро гитаре на подобие distortion и ревербиратор, гитара подключена к микрофонному входу, искаженный звук должен выходить сразу как был подан сигнал на звуковую карту?


 
Vampiro   (2003-04-26 14:16) [1]

попробуй разобрать с некторыми мультимедийными приложениями типа mmtools


 
Sergo ©   (2003-04-28 16:34) [2]

Есть книга "Обработка звука на РС" там рассказана математика искажения звука.
Только тебе звукаха нужна будет высопроизводительная (наподобие Creative Audigy, у Live 5.1 небольшое отставание есть).


 
Style ©   (2003-04-29 08:33) [3]

Артем1-> Для начала научись загружать WAVE файл в память
И попробуй построить спектр на потобие как во всех звуковых программах. Принцип построения не сложный..

т.е если звук 16bit
то у тебя должен быть массив с данными типа
array of word
array of byte для 8битного звука.. Частота 22Khz Частота 48Khz
это как бы так объяснить простым языком = диапазон четкости т.е
в 1 сек звучания помещается определенное кол-во байт, чем больше частота тем больше и размер буффера..

Что такое Дисторшн - завышение амплитуды спектра на определенный коеффициен который переводя в Децибелы в процентном соотношении. Ну а сдесь чистая математика.
В принципе - все что больше нуля + k все что меньше нуля - k
Только нужно учесть опять формат звукового файла.
signed
unsigned

В плане инструмента:
С начала можешь поэкспериментировать с MMSYTEM
---
Хотя куда проще DelphiX
// Там довольно хорошие компоненты работы со звуком через DirectX!



Страницы: 1 вся ветка

Текущий архив: 2003.08.28;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.014 c
1-92094
Man
2003-08-15 13:30
2003.08.28
работа с dll в Inno Setup


7-92293
pet
2003-06-15 19:57
2003.08.28
MBR


14-92228
NIKKI
2003-08-10 09:28
2003.08.28
Языки программирования


14-92177
panov
2003-08-08 23:00
2003.08.28
О форумах.


3-92019
Falendysh
2003-08-05 00:16
2003.08.28
QReport компонента